The Fiat 131 2000 Racing is a sedan powered by a petrol engine delivering 115 hp (85 kW). It acc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 10.0 s and reaches a top speed of 180 km/h. Fuel efficiency stands at 10.3 l/100 km combined. Drive is routed to the front-wheel-drive axle via a manual. This variant was introduced in 1978 as part of the Fiat 131 (1978-1982) generation, and sits alongside 1 other variant in this generation.
